What can we conclude from the statement that the action and absorption spectrum of phtosynthetic overlaps? At which wavelength do they show peaks. ?

Text Solution

AI Generated Solution

### Step-by-Step Solution: 1. **Understanding Photosynthesis**: - Photosynthesis is the process by which plants convert light energy into chemical energy, producing their own food using sunlight, carbon dioxide, and water. 2. **Defining Absorption Spectrum**: - The absorption spectrum is a graph that shows how much light of different wavelengths is absorbed by chlorophyll and other pigments in the plant. It indicates the specific wavelengths of light that are absorbed during photosynthesis. ...
